Shakamak defense falters against Cougars (High School Sports ~ 01/17/15)
JASONVILLE - North Daviess shot 65 percent overall, including 50 percent from 3-point range, as the visiting Cougars defeated Shakamak 66-51 in a Southwestern Indiana Athletic Conference boys basketball game here Friday night. North Daviess improved to 3-10, 1-1 in the conference. Shakamak dropped its seventh consecutive contest, falling to 3-10, 0-3 in the SWIAC... -

UPDATED: Miners cruise to second win over Rivet (High School Sports ~ 01/17/15)
Linton-Stockton rode 70 percent shooting and an 11-0 first-quarter run to a 73-45 win over the Vincennes Rivet Patriots in a rematch of the Greene County Invitational championship game won by the Miners last Saturday. "Our kids are doing a great job of sharing the ball," Miner coach Joey Hart said in explaining his team's shooting performance. "We really moved the ball well."... -

UPDATED: Cards come from behind to nip Miners (High School Sports ~ 01/17/15)
The Bloomfield Cardinals mounted a fourth quarter comeback to win 32-29 over the Linton-Stockton Miners in a SWIAC conference boys high school basketball game at Linton-Stockton Saturday night. Trailing 24-18 after three quarters, two 3-pointers by Cardinal center Brandon Van Sant and clutch free throw shooting by Conner Dowden and Drake Frederick propelled the Cards to a 14-point quarter to overtake the Miners, who only managed five points in the final period...
